Spotting and Avoiding Phishing Emails

Phishing emails are a common danger that can harm data. These malicious emails often appear legitimate, trying to convince you to giving away personal details. To stay safe online, it's crucial to be aware of the signs of phishing communications.

Be wary when opening messages sent by unfamiliar addresses. Scrutinize the sender's email address for any grammatical mistakes. Phishing messages often use scare tactics. Don't be fooled by these deceptive methods.

  • Be cautious about clicking links in emails from suspicious addresses. It's advisable to type the URL into your browser instead.
  • Don't share sensitive data via online communication. Legitimate organizations will not request account credentials through email.

Be Wary When Clicking

In today's digital landscape, digital risks are ever-present, and phishing attacks remain a common strategy used by cybercriminals to acquire sensitive information. These attacks often involve spam that seem trustworthy in an attempt to lure you into sharing personal data like login credentials, credit card information, or social security numbers.

To protect yourself from these cunning attacks, it's crucial to remain aware when clicking on links or opening attachments in emails.

Confirm the email address before responding or clicking any links. Hover your cursor over links to reveal their true destination. Be wary of pressure tactics as phishing attempts often employ these tactics for influencing you into acting quickly without thinking.

Moreover, keep your software up to revision and use a reputable antivirus program to protect your devices from malicious programs. By implementing these strategies, you can significantly reduce your risk of becoming a victim of phishing attacks.
